Trending Topics in Auto Insurance:

1. Usage-Based Insurance: Usage-based insurance, also known as pay-as-you-drive or pay-how-you-drive insurance, is a growing trend in auto insurance. This type of insurance uses telematics devices to track a driver’s behavior, such as speed, acceleration, and braking, to determine their insurance premium. Drivers who exhibit safe driving habits can benefit from lower insurance rates.

2. Autonomous Vehicles: With the development of autonomous vehicles, auto insurance companies are starting to consider how insurance policies will need to adapt to this new technology. Insurance for autonomous vehicles may focus more on the technology and software systems rather than individual driver behavior.

3. Cybersecurity Insurance: As cars become more connected through technology, the risk of cyber attacks on vehicles is increasing. Cybersecurity insurance for vehicles is a trending topic in auto insurance, with policies designed to protect against hacking and data breaches that could compromise the safety and security of the vehicle.

4. Usage-Based Pricing: Many auto insurance companies are moving towards usage-based pricing, where premiums are calculated based on how often and how far a driver drives. This can be a more cost-effective option for drivers who do not use their vehicles frequently or for long distances.

5. Personalized Insurance: Personalized insurance policies tailored to individual driver profiles are becoming more popular in the auto insurance industry. By considering factors such as driving habits, mileage, and location, insurance companies can offer customized coverage options that better meet the needs of each driver.

6. What is the difference between collision and comprehensive coverage?

– Collision coverage pays for damage to your vehicle in the event of a collision with another vehicle or object, while comprehensive coverage pays for damage to your vehicle from non-collision events such as theft, vandalism, or natural disasters.

9. What is uninsured/underinsured motorist coverage?

– Uninsured/underinsured motorist coverage provides protection in the event you are involved in an accident with a driver who does not have insurance or does not have enough insurance to cover the damages.

11. How does my age impact my car insurance premium?

– Young drivers under the age of 25 typically pay higher insurance premiums due to their lack of driving experience and increased likelihood of accidents. On the other hand, drivers over the age of 65 may also see higher premiums due to age-related factors that could impact their driving ability.

12. What is a deductible and how does it affect my car insurance premium?

– A deductible is the amount you pay out of pocket before your insurance coverage kicks in. Choosing a higher deductible can lower your insurance premium, but it’s important to consider whether you can afford the deductible in the event of a claim.
